My H1B visa label is expired?Employer A sponsored my H1B and I am working for Employer B[USCIS approved I-797]?

Legally the company only needs to pay for the application and lawyer fees. They may pay for your travel - but they don't have to. Also, you do not need to travel to get the visa stamped in, you can instead seek an extensition/change using form I-539.

If you travel out of US however, you will need to go to the consulate and then get the actual visa.
